# Copperbench Admin Environments

Bulk edits in the Copperbench admin table behave differently per environment, which trips people up. In sandbox, bulk ops are capped at 50 rows and run synchronously; staging and prod queue them through the Heron worker pool, so edits can lag a minute or two. If on-call gets pinged about "stuck" bulk edits, check the worker queue before anything else. The staging queue runs with these configuration values.

service settings:
PRAIX_LOG_LEVEL=error
PRAIX_METRICS_HOST=metrics.praix.qorvelcorp.corp
PRAIX_POOL_SIZE=16

TICKET: Config drift on Schemata registry (prod vs. staging). Detected during quarterly audit of the Fennelworth event platform. Prod instance of the Schemata schema registry has compatibility mode set to NONE while staging enforces BACKWARD. Also, auth plugin versions differ. Drift likely introduced during the Velgrave hotfix window. Security review requested before we re-sync, since loosened compatibility allows unvetted event shapes. No customer impact observed yet. Current prod configuration values are reproduced below for review.

config for kafof-bawef:
holath:
  log_level: debug
  metrics_host: metrics.holath.qorvelsys.internal
  pin: 2191
  pool_size: 32

### 4.3 Tax-rate lookup cache

The Fernwick billing service resolves a tax rate for every line item, and the upstream rate authority enforces strict request quotas. We therefore cache rates keyed by jurisdiction and product class, with a conservative TTL and a stale-while-revalidate window so checkout latency stays flat during refreshes. Future maintainers should note that rates legally change on published effective dates, so the TTL must never exceed the shortest notice period we support. The governing constants are as follows.

limits module of bawef-bajep:
CAPS = {
    "novvan": 877,
    "quenvan": 327,
}